Andreas> Oh well, I've never tried to configure an Oily box. What must
Andreas> I do to switch video modes etc.?
Recall the 2.88Mo configuration floppy, yes ? So get all this floppy
on a floppy of the right size and put it in a floppy drive of also the
right size... If you don't have any of these wonderfull 2.88Mo award
items all you can do is to put all the floppy contents in a directory
on a hard disk: what I do usually - from time to time this spare disk
is involved in other stuff ;) - is extracting all the disks (1 to 4) in
\olli in a little FAT partition, then add a env variable for
convience from the 'system services' prompt: it's something like
>setenv C:=scsi(0)disk(<scsi_id>)rdisk(<LUN>)partition(<part_number>)
Well it's a standard ARC BIOS path, I don't recall the exact syntax
right now.
Then issue on the 'system services' prompt something like:
>A:\SD.EXE - if you're lucky enough to be 2.88Mo equipped
>C:\SD.EXE - otherwise
Then it's an usual PC/EISA configuration software, you will find the
video parameters by looking the details of 'motherboard' in the EISA
card listing.
